What if Northumbria was born long before the kingdom ever carried its name?

In the centuries after Roman rule faded from Britain, a new northern power began to take shape. But where did its people come from, and how did Bernicia rise from a landscape already filled with British kingdoms, Roman military traditions, and Germanic communities?


NORTHUMBRIA follows the clues behind one of Britain's most fascinating beginnings, from the collapse of Roman government to the rise of Ida and the founding of the Iding dynasty at Bamburgh.


Few people know that the Germanic presence in Britain may have begun long before the traditional story of Hengest and Horsa. Germanic soldiers were already serving within Roman Britain, including Frisians, Batavians, Tungrians, and others. Could some of their communities have survived the end of Roman authority and helped form the foundations of later kingdoms?


Another possibility leads south to Lincolnshire, where an early Anglian settlement may have developed into a powerful base. From there, Anglian communities may have expanded through East Anglia and Deira toward the northern lands of Bernicia. Even the name Lindisfarne offers a tantalizing connection with Lindsay, the Anglo-Saxon name associated with Lincolnshire.


What you're about to discover will change how you see the origins of Northumbria. Rather than presenting a single unquestioned answer, this book brings together three competing explanations and examines how migration, military settlement, population growth, conquest, and dynastic power may have combined to create a northern kingdom.


Inside, you'll encounter Vortigern, Hengest and Horsa, the Germanic soldiers of Roman Britain, the Tyne Valley, Bamburgh, Ida, Bernicia, Deira, Lincolnshire, and Lindisfarne, all within the larger story of Britain's transformation after Rome.
